Students and working professional who needs to manage multiple timelines.
Duke aims to improve time management of users and provide a seamless and intuitive experience.
| Version | As a … | I want to … | So that I can … |
|---|---|---|---|
| v1.0 | user | be able to add a to-do | keep track memorising them |
| v1.0 | user | be able to add an event | keep track without memorising them |
| v1.0 | user | be able to add a deadline | keep track without memorising them |
| v1.0 | user | view my entire task list | refer to the details whenever |
| v1.0 | user | delete tasks | remove redundant ones |
| v1.0 | user | mark tasks as completed | keep track of the progress without memorising them |
| v2.0 | user | view my task list by status | review the incomplete tasks |
| v2.0 | user | be reminded of my upcoming events and deadlines | will not forget them and work on them immediately, respectively |
| v2.0 | user | filter my list by event dates and/or deadlines | review the tasks for the specified day |
| v3.0 | user | associate a task to another | finish them sequentially |
| v3.0 | user | add notes to a task | keep track of the details |
| v3.0 | user | delete notes of a task | remove unnecessary ones |
| v3.0 | user | update existing notes | it is up-to-date |
| v4.0 | user | view tasks that has notes | review these tasks |
| v4.0 | user | search tasks by keywords in notes | review tasks based on the keywords |
